What is the correct format for a college application essay?

For my essay, do I need to put a creative title as the header or do I need to restate the prompt?

What font should I use for the actual paper?

Do I just put on a straight title or do I need to put on a whole header, with my name and the date included?

I'm submitting the essay online, through common application, so they will already know who sent the essay.

  1. I’m not an english teacher or an admissions officer, but maybe I can simply give my opinion. I would try to think of a creative title, simply because your essay should make the prompt very clear. It’s also probably a good idea to use a standard font– Times New Roman, Arial, Georgia, Verdana, or any other that is easily readable. I would say it’s definitely a good idea to put your name as well. It does no harm, and may help the readability of your essay– imagine being able to put a name to an essay, rather than having it feel like a ghost-writer! I also don’t see any harm in dating it. I’m sure that Admissions would love to see more information rather than less. Hope this helps!
